1. City Hall – Iconic Elegance
Best For: Classic, Elegant, or Intimate Weddings
San Francisco City Hall is a timeless venue offering jaw-dropping architecture, marble staircases, and a majestic rotunda. With various rental packages—ranging from a simple one-hour ceremony to an exclusive evening affair—it’s ideal for couples seeking grandeur without complications.
Pro Tip: Book well in advance for Friday evenings, the most coveted time slots.
2. The Conservatory of Flowers – Botanical Romance
Best For: Garden, Whimsical, or Nature-Loving Couples
Located in Golden Gate Park, this Victorian greenhouse bursts with exotic blooms and tropical charm. It’s perfect for couples who want a lush, natural setting without leaving the city.
What Makes It Special: A sunset ceremony in the Palm Terrace Garden, followed by a reception among the orchids.
3. Foreign Cinema – Edgy and Elegant
Best For: Foodies, Film Buffs, and Urban Vibes
One of San Francisco’s most unique venues, Foreign Cinema combines gourmet cuisine with a sleek industrial aesthetic. Picture this: dining under string lights while classic films play silently on the courtyard wall. It’s hip, romantic, and effortlessly cool.
Capacity: Up to 300 guests
Why It Stands Out: Award-winning menu and cinematic atmosphere.
4. The Green Room – Vintage Glamour
Best For: Art Deco Fans and Elegant Affairs
Housed within the San Francisco War Memorial & Performing Arts Center, The Green Room features tall arched windows, ornate ceilings, and a palette of soft jade and gold. It’s a refined choice for couples who love historical charm with modern amenities.
Bonus: Its proximity to the Opera House and City Hall makes for convenient photo ops.

6. The Pearl – Contemporary Cool
Best For: Modern Minimalists and Art Enthusiasts
Located in the Dogpatch neighborhood, The Pearl is a stunning industrial-chic venue featuring reclaimed wood walls, exposed beams, and a rooftop terrace. It also houses rotating art installations, giving your wedding a gallery-meets-party vibe.
Extras: In-house coordination, top-tier lighting, and cutting-edge audio/visual support.
7. Presidio Log Cabin – Rustic Retreat with a View
Best For: Rustic, Military History Lovers, or Outdoor Fans
Tucked into the Presidio forest, this charming log cabin venue offers a rustic yet intimate atmosphere. With views of the Golden Gate Bridge and surrounded by nature, it’s ideal for couples who want a forest-meets-ocean vibe.
Insider Tip: The cabin offers outdoor picnic tables and indoor fireplaces—perfect for cozy receptions.
Venue Booking Tips for San Francisco Brides and Grooms:
- Secure early: Popular wedding venues in San Francisco book 12–18 months in advance, especially spring and fall dates.
- Budget smart: Venue rentals in SF can range from $1,000 (City Hall ceremonies) to $20,000+ for luxury venues.
- Consider permits: Outdoor venues like Golden Gate Park or Sutro Heights often require permits and insurance.
